The Importance Of Getting A DNA Test: Understanding Your Genetic Makeup

In recent years, DNA testing has become increasingly popular as people seek to learn more about their genetic makeup and ancestry Whether you’re curious about your heritage, looking to connect with long-lost relatives, or simply want to learn more about your health and wellness, getting a DNA test can provide valuable insights into your unique genetic code.

One of the most common reasons people choose to get a DNA test is to learn more about their ancestry With the rise of companies like AncestryDNA and 23andMe, it’s easier than ever to trace your roots and discover where your ancestors came from By analyzing your DNA, these tests can provide a breakdown of your ethnic background, showing you the percentage of your DNA that comes from different regions around the world This information can be fascinating for many people, helping them better understand their cultural heritage and connect with distant relatives who share similar genetic markers.

In addition to learning about your ancestry, DNA testing can also provide valuable insights into your health and wellness Many DNA tests now offer reports on genetic predispositions to various health conditions, such as heart disease, cancer, and Alzheimer’s By understanding your genetic risks, you can take proactive steps to improve your health and potentially prevent certain diseases before they develop For example, if you learn that you have a higher risk of heart disease, you may choose to adopt a healthier diet and exercise routine to lower your chances of developing cardiovascular problems in the future.

By comparing your DNA with others in a DNA database, you may be able to find close relatives who share common genetic markers with you This can be a life-changing experience for many people, providing them with a sense of connection and belonging that they may have been missing.

If you’re considering getting a DNA test, it’s important to choose a reputable testing company that prioritizes privacy and data security Before purchasing a test kit, do some research to ensure that the company has a good track record of protecting customer information and following ethical guidelines for genetic testing It’s also a good idea to read reviews from other customers to see what their experiences were like and whether they would recommend the service to others.

Once you’ve received your DNA test results, take some time to review the findings and consider how they may impact your life If you have any questions or concerns about the results, don’t hesitate to reach out to a genetic counselor or healthcare provider for guidance They can help you interpret the data and make informed decisions about your health and well-being based on the information provided in your DNA report.
